Exploring Copper Core Cookware Essentials

Copper core cookware represents a premium category in culinary tools, combining the excellent thermal conductivity of copper with the durability and ease of maintenance of other metals. This type of cookware is crafted to cater to both professional chefs and culinary enthusiasts who seek superior performance in their cooking vessels.

Composition and Construction

At the heart of copper core cookware is a layer of copper sandwiched between layers of other heat-stable materials such as stainless steel. This construction ensures even heat distribution, reducing hotspots that can cause uneven cooking. The outer layers protect the copper, preventing it from reacting with acidic foods and making the cookware more durable.

Types and Varieties

The range of copper core cookware includes a variety of pots and pans, each designed for specific culinary tasks. From sauté pans to stockpots, the selection caters to diverse cooking methods. Skillets from this category are particularly sought after for their excellent heat control, which is essential for searing and sautéing.

Functional Advantages

Cookware with a copper core is renowned for its superior heat conductivity, which allows for precise temperature control. This is crucial for delicate dishes that require consistent temperatures. Additionally, the robust construction of these pots and pans ensures longevity, making them a staple in kitchens for years to come.

Care and Maintenance

Maintaining copper core pots and pans involves routine cleaning with gentle detergents and avoiding abrasive materials that can scratch the surface. While the copper core is encased, the cookware often features a stainless steel exterior that is dishwasher safe, although hand washing is recommended to preserve the finish.
